I have just replaced a MyCloud Home with a MyCloud EX2 Ultra and I’m setting up the Ultra for the first Time.
The setup appeared to complete exactly as I expected. It’s configured to RAID 0, both disks have been checked/verified by the system and report as good. I have setup 1 User and 1 Share (as public). I am logged onto my Windows laptop as the same “User”. If I check File Explorer via my Windows 10 laptop, the device is visible under under Network Locations, but if I click on the Network device (MyCloudEX2Ultra), it cannot see the Share and simply reports as “Windows cannot access \ MYCLOUDEX2ULTRA”. However, if I try exactly the same thing on my Windows 7 laptop, everything appears normal and I can see the Share in Windows Explorer. I have checked the Windows 10 optional features and “SMB 1.0/CIFS Client” (and Server) are both checked as ON.
So, why is there a difference between the Windows 10 handling of the WD Ultra versus the handling by Windows 7 ? What do I need to do to get the Share visible under Windows 10 ?
